Naiteitei Mose is from Euless, Texas, DFW area.

He was listed as a senior at Georgetown last year. He was a second team All-Patriot League selection and had 63 tackles, 6 TFL, 1 sack, 5 hurries, 1 int, 2 fum rec, one for a TD. If his highlight reel is any indication, he attacks the ball from every angle.
